December 8, 2004 - Tuesday Night (8:00-11:00 p.m.)
Excluding the night of the presidential election (11/02/04), ABC attracted its largest Tuesday audience (11.5 million) and its top Adult 18-49 rating (4.1/11) on the night in over 1 year - excluding nights with sports programming -- since 11/11/03 and 11/25/03, respectively.
ABC won the night across each of the key men demographics (Men 18-34 - 3.0/10, Men 18-49 - 3.9/11 and Men 25-54 - 4.3/11), Teens 12-17 (2.3/8) and Kids 2-11 (3.5/15).
ABC delivered its top Kids 2-11 performance on the night in over 2-1/2 years - since 5/14/02.
"A Charlie Brown Christmas" (8:00-9:00 p.m.)
First airing in 1965, ABC's rebroadcast "A Charlie Brown Christmas" won its hour across all key adult demographics (Adults 18-34 - 4.2/13, Adults 18-49 - 4.8/13 and Adults 25-54 - 5.4/13), Teens 12-17 (3.5/12) and Kids 2-11 (7.2/24).
"A Charlie Brown Christmas" delivered its best numbers ever on ABC in Total Viewers (13.8 million) and Adults 18-49 (4.8/16).
"A Charlie Brown Christmas" posted ABC's strongest performance in the hour in viewers and young adults in over 1 year - since 11/04/03. In addition, ABC saw its best Kids 2-11 rating in the hour in over 3 years - since 10/30/01.
"According to Jim" (9:00-9:30 p.m.)
A repeat "According to Jim" drew 11.7 million viewers and a 4.3 rating, 11 share among Adults 18-49, making it the most-watched program in its time period for the second time in 3 weeks. In addition, the family sitcom led its half-hour among Men 18-49 (3.9/10), Teens 12-17 (3.0/9) and Kids 2-11 (3.2/13).
"According to Jim" drew its largest audience and highest ratings ever among Men 18-49 and Kids 2-11 for a repeat episode. Additionally, the show matched its second-best Adults 18-49 rating ever for a rebroadcast.
"Rodney" (9:30-10:00 p.m.)
"Rodney" finished second in its time slot in Total Viewers (10.2 million) and Adults 18-49 (3.9/10), outperforming its NBC comedy competition by nearly 3 million viewers and by 15% in young adults (7.3 million & 3.4/9 - "Scrubs").
The ABC freshman comedy hit series highs across Men 18-34 (3.2/10) and Men 18-49 (3.8/10).
"NYPD Blue" (10:00-11:00 p.m.)
"NYPD Blue" placed second in its hour, leading CBS' "Judging Amy" by 10% among Adults 18-49 (3.4/9 vs. 3.1/9).
